Since I can’t comment on editorial comics, and I can’t talk directly to GoC, I thought I’d mention an article in the WaPo in the comments of a couple of my favourite editorial comics other comments:
“[W]hen influencers disable comments on their posts, viewers respond negatively. They regard influencers as less likable and are less likely to engage with the products they promote than when influencers leave their comments on, according to the study published in April in the Journal of Marketing.
“Influencers are “so good at making it seem like they’re our friends,” said Freeman Wu, an author of the study and assistant professor of marketing at Vanderbilt. “So when they turn off these comments, it basically shatters that illusion.””
